This book explores the morphological traits, ethnopharmacological properties, and biologically active secondary metabolites of medicinal plants. Ethnopharmacology, the systematic study of traditional medicines, remains a valuable source of innovative drugs and pharmaceutical lead compounds. Plant secondary metabolites, whether used alone or in combination, can be effective and safe alternatives when synthetic drugs fall short. The book delves into these metabolites, including methods for their targeted expression and purification.
In addition to examining the morphological characteristics, ethnopharmacological uses, biological and pharmacological effects, and clinical trial findings, this comprehensive guide covers 56 plant species. It also discusses plant cell culture conditions and various techniques to enhance the production of these vital secondary metabolites.
